In student-driven learning environments, students are empowered to make decisions about when they will tackle various activities in and out of the classroom.

Here is an example of a third grade activity list from which students would choose and schedule activities. The overall problem students are working to solve is the loss of habitat that is endangering the future of butterflies. Students are to design a butterfly garden to build and to promote in the community to see if others would build them as well.
